Ramon Bilbao Rioja Edicion Limitada Garnacha 2021
' Ramon Bilbao is a renowned Spanish winery based in Rioja, known for producing high-quality wines that blend tradition with innovation. Established in 1924, the winery specializes in crafting elegant, complex wines, with a focus on Tempranillo grapes. Their top-tier wine, Mirto, is made from old vines in select vineyards and is produced only in exceptional years, reflecting the excellence and craftsmanship that define the Ramon Bilbao legacy. The grapes come from select vineyards in Rioja Oriental, located in towns like Tudelilla, Grávalos, Arnedo, and Monte Yerga. The Garnacha vines are grown on low trellises in limestone-rich alluvial soils. The vineyards are at 600 meters altitude, facing east-west. Handpicked grapes are carefully selected. The wine is fermented in concrete tanks at low temperatures, with gentle pump-overs to softly extract the flavors. It is aged for 12 months in French oak barrels (second and third use) to preserve the Garnacha's elegant fruit, followed by 6 more months in concrete before bottling. The 2020 harvest took place in vineyards across Rioja Oriental, including towns like Tudelilla, Grávalos, and Arnedo. The Garnacha vines grow on low trellises in limestone-rich alluvial soils, at 600 meters altitude, with east-west exposure. '
Ramon Bilbao Rioja Vinedos de Altura 2021

The grapes come from two areas: Ãbalos for Tempranillo and Tudelilla for Garnacha. The altitude of over 700 meters gives the fruit freshness and elegance. Ãbalos: Sandy soils with decomposed limestone bedrock. Tudelilla: Poor, rocky soils. Grapes are carefully selected, with maceration before fermentation to extract aromas and colours. The two varieties are fermented separately to capture their unique characteristics. Malolactic fermentation takes place in French oak vats with the wine on its lees, followed by 15 months of aging. 2020 harvest was a vintage of extremes. Late autumn and early winter were very mild. However, a frost in April reduced production. This vintage has been rated as ''Memorable''. '
